动荡的混合控制着不断增长的对抗性种群的固定

概括
具有对抗性相互作用的微生物群体可以避免混合,一种菌株可以主导另一种菌株,这一过程称为固定. 动荡的流动影响了这种竞争,影响了哪些生物存活下来,并导致了独特的生态结果.

背景情况:
- 微生物群落往往表现出复杂的相互作用,包括对抗性,其中一种物种抑制另一个物种.
- 动荡的流体流可以显著影响自然环境中的微生物的空间分布和相互作用.
研究的目的:
- 研究微生物菌株之间的对抗性相互作用如何受到流流体流动的影响.
- 了解生物竞争和流体向导的系统中人口固定的动态.
主要方法:
- 用连续模型的数值模拟来研究两个对抗性微生物菌株.
- 该模型包含了两个空间维度中的不可压缩的流.
- 分析的关键参数包括流体运输时间与生物繁殖时间的比率.
主要成果:
- 发现流会增加生物核形成的门,使新种群的建立变得更加困难.
- 已被证明,对抗性通过减少菌株间接口的种群密度来抑制流动诱导的混合.
- 流体运输与繁殖时间的比率被确定为决定固定结果的关键因素.
结论:
- 流和对抗性微生物动态之间的相互作用导致了不寻常的生态后果.
- 这些发现对了解海洋环境中的微生物生态和生物性起源有潜在的影响.

Hybrid zones are narrow regions where two closely related species interact, mate, and produce hybrids. Relative to either parent species, hybrids may possess distinct phenotypic or genetic differences that impact their survival and reproductive success. The genetic variances introduced by hybridization influence species diversity and speciation processes within the hybrid zone.

In a population that is not at Hardy-Weinberg equilibrium, the frequency of alleles changes over time. Therefore, any deviations from the five conditions of Hardy-Weinberg equilibrium can alter the genetic variation of a given population. Conditions that change the genetic variability of a population include mutations, natural selection, non-random mating, gene flow, and genetic drift (small population size).

Gene flow is the transfer of genes among populations, resulting from either the dispersal of gametes or from the migration of individuals.
